Printer completes print production jobs on various types of printing press machines, including digital, flexographic, web, screen, or others. Reviews job specifications and complete setup tasks, including filling ink, calibrating machine, and loading stock. Being a Printer conducts visual inspection of samples prior to running job. Performs in-process quality inspections utilizing standard testing protocols. Additionally, Printer completes all required production logs and documentation. Interprets equipment diagnostics, troubleshoots breakdowns, and makes necessary adjustments to complete the job. Performs regular maintenance, cleaning, and changeovers of press from one job to another. Maintains a clean and safe workspace. Requires a high school diploma or equivalent. Typically reports to a supervisor. The Printer works under moderate supervision. Gaining or has attained full proficiency in a specific area of discipline. To be a Printer typically requires 1-3 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
